ubuntu下r8125网卡重启丢失修复案例一则

刚装的一台服务器,ubuntu24.04,主板网卡是r8125,安装服务后会莫名其妙丢失驱动

按照官网的方法下载最新8125驱动包:

Realtek

然后卸载驱动

rmmod r8125

然后在驱动包里安装(幸好我之前装了build-essential,不然就在这步完蛋了)

./autorun.sh

弄了几遍还是不行,ifconfig里没看到网卡

捣鼓半天,发现用ifconfig -a能看到网卡,说明网卡没起来。检查是dhcp没有成功获取,使用dhclient命令又能启动。见了鬼了

最后定位是dhcp客户端没有正常获取

cd /etc/netplan/

发现有一个配置50-cloud-init.yaml

打开看,发现网卡的名称和现在的网卡居然不一致,也许因为升级或重装驱动后网卡名变了吧。

vi /etc/netplan/50-cloud-init.yaml

把ethernets下的网卡修改和现在的一致,然后重启就好了

我的是把enp3s0修改成了enp4s0

相关推荐
YXXY3137 小时前
线程的介绍(四)
linux
kTR2hD1qb9 小时前
从 Responses API 到 Chat Completions:一个模型网关的设计复盘
linux·前端
姓刘的哦10 小时前
大模型祛魅
linux
hj28625111 小时前
linux下一步学习内容
linux·运维
xier_ran12 小时前
【infra之路】Linux基础命令与系统排查
linux·运维·服务器
zh路西法12 小时前
【Linux 串口通信】基于 C++ 多线程的同步/异步串口实现
linux·运维·c++·python
c2385612 小时前
linux基础2
linux·运维·服务器
子兮曰12 小时前
WSL 配 GPU 用 Docker 的折腾指南(2026 年版)
linux·前端·后端
vortex512 小时前
Linux 默认 SUID 可执行文件详解
linux·运维
2023自学中13 小时前
Linux虚拟机 CMakeLists.txt:x86 与 ARM 双架构编译脚本
linux·c语言·c++·嵌入式